How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Crystal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Crystal Park Studio Apartments | $732 | $715 | $750 |
Crystal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,020 | $635 | $1,700 |
| Crystal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,481 | $770 | $4,505 |
| Crystal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,087 | $950 | $1,550 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Crystal Park Apartments
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Crystal Park?
The cheapest apartment in Crystal Park is Newton Family Apartments which is listed at $350, while the average apartment in Crystal Park costs $950.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Crystal Park?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 3 regular apartments in Crystal Park that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Crystal Park?
Cheap apartments in Crystal Park have an average cost of $357 which is $593 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Crystal Park.
